The2002 Jackson County Executive election took place on November 5, 2002. Incumbent Democratic County ExecutiveKatheryn Shields ran for re-election to a third term.[1]
Shields initially faced a challenge in the Democratic primary from State SenatorRonnie DePasco,[2] but he ultimately withdrew from the race. Shields won the primary in a landslide,[3] and faced Republican State Representative Pat Kelley in the general election. She defeated Kelley by a wide margin, becoming the first County Executive to be elected to three terms.[4]
